This page covers escalation for the Moonreach tide-table widget embedded in the Harborlight app. For data discrepancies (wrong tide heights or times), first confirm the station ID in the widget settings matches the customer's harbour. Rendering issues should include a screenshot and browser version. For anything unresolved after these checks, contact the widget maintainers directly.

billing contact of yadug-tahof = ulamir@norvacorp.internal

# Lumen Tier Launch — Managers Only

Quick rundown for heads of department: the new Lumen tier at Pressfield Apps goes live soon. Think faster exports, team dashboards, and the Wrenly add-on bundled in. Pricing lands between Core and Summit. Keep it quiet until the announcement. Here's the confidential bit you actually need to know.

board note of tadup-tajog: Headcount on the Oliiel team goes from 31 to 88 by the end of February. Gross margin on Oliiel came in at 62 percent against a plan of 29 percent.

// TRACE_HEADER_KEY: the canonical header Quillgate services use to
// propagate request identity across hops. Plugins MUST forward this
// header unchanged on every outbound call, including retries and
// fan-out requests. Do not generate your own IDs; the gateway mints
// one at ingress. Omitting it breaks span stitching in Lanternview
// and your plugin will fail certification. For local testing against
// the sandbox, use the sample trace token below.

trace token, fafog-kageg: htk4_98e6

Handover Note — from Director Pellam to Director Rusk

Re: launch of the Meridian Plus subscription tier.

Pricing approved; billing build 80% complete. Finance to confirm revenue recognition treatment before go-live. Churn model from the Averleigh pilot sits in the shared planning folder. Outstanding: tax review for the Northgate region and final margin sign-off. Flag blockers to me this week. Confidential business-plan note appended below.

board note of kafog-bajep: Briathek Partners is in early talks to buy Aldaelek Group for about $47.1 million. The Ulaath launch date is September 4, and nothing goes to the press before then.